Red Sox celebration had an awkward start since they had clinched the division with a Jays loss that night while their game with the Yankees was still going on, only to lose on a walkoff grand slam after blowing a 3-0 lead in the ninth. They trudge into the locker room and five minutes later are spraying each other like they won the World Series. One thing that was particularly annoying was the September call-ups who aren't even going to be on the post-season roster going the craziest. The only smart one was Dustin Pedroia, who stayed off to the side the whole time acting like he had been the before and knowing that there are bigger fish to fry (probably also still pissed about losing the way they did).
